1999 Supreme(Del) 56

A.D.SINGH
INDO GULF EXPLOSIVES LIMITED – Appellant
Versus
UPSIDC – Respondent


Advocates Appeared:
M.K.Garg, P.N.LEKHI, Shil Sethi

Anil Dev Singh, J.

( 1 ) THE first petitioner is a Company set-up for the purposes of manufacturing industrial explosives. Dr. S. K. Garg is the Chairman-cum-Managing Director of the first peti- tioner. At the request of the first petitioner, the second respondent - the State of Uttar Pradesh, decided to hand over 50 acres of land to the former on lease and 656 acres on licence basis in Villages Prithvipura, Nayakhera, and Koti, Pargana and Tehsil Jhansi, Distt. Jhansi, in the State of Uttar Pradesh. While 50 acres of land was required for set- ting up of the factory for manufacture of explosives, the remaining land was required to fulfil the requirements of Indian Explosives Act, 1884 and the rules framed thereunder for the purposes of a safety zone of 760 metres radius around the factory. The first petitioner in the project was to be assisted by Pradeshiya Industrial and Investment Corporation of Uttar Pradesh (for short picup ) and the first respondent - Uttar Pradesh State Industrial Development Corporation (for short upsidc ).
